Siddapura - Tikota, Vijayapura
Siddapura is a village situated in the Tikota taluka of Vijayapura district, Karnataka. It is located approximately 20 km from Bijapur and around 20 km from Bijapur. Arakeri serves as the Gram Panchayat for Siddapura village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Siddapura is 599040. The village covers a total geographical area of 1465 hectares and falls under the 586130 pincode. Bijapur is the nearest town, located about 20 km away.
Siddapura village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a President ser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Babaleshwar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Vijayapura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Siddapura
According to the 2011 Census, Siddapura village had a total population of 4,400 people, including 2,260 males and 2,140 females, living in 719 households. The sex ratio was 947 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 53.26%, with male literacy at 64.12% and female literacy at 42.10%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 2,214,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 86.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 4,400 | 2,260 | 2,140 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 677 | 373 | 304 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 2,214 | 1,159 | 1,055 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 86 | 45 | 41 |
| Literate Population | 1,983 | 1,210 | 773 |
| Illiterate Population | 2,417 | 1,050 | 1,367 |

Transport and Connectivity of Siddapura
Siddapura is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Siddapura.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| Available within >10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Bijapur to Siddapura is about 20 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Siddapura
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Siddapura village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within >10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Post Office | Yes | Available within village |
Health Facilities in Siddapura
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Siddapura village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
